Dual-booting has gained significant popularity among individuals with a keen interest in technology and professionals who desire the convenience of operating multiple operating systems on a single device.
Although the process can be fulfilling, it is important to acknowledge that certain obstacles, such as navigating the complexities of UEFI (Unified Extensible Firmware Interface), may present themselves.
This comprehensive guide aims to provide an in-depth exploration of the complexities associated with dual booting, while also offering instructions on the process of disabling UEFI in order to facilitate the smooth operation of any desired operating system on your computer.
Understanding Dual Booting and UEFI
The concept of dual booting involves the installation and execution of two distinct operating systems on a single computer system. This feature enables users to seamlessly alternate between the two operating systems during the startup process, thereby granting them the ability to leverage a broader spectrum of software applications and functionalities.
The Unified Extensible Firmware Interface (UEFI) is a contemporary alternative to the conventional Basic Input/Output System (BIOS) that is commonly encountered in computer systems. The UEFI (Unified Extensible Firmware Interface) offers a range of enhanced capabilities and performance, including heightened security measures and expedited boot durations.
When dual-booting with UEFI, there are a few important considerations:
1. Partitioning: Each operating system in a dual boot configuration needs its own partition on the hard drive. The partition sizes can be adjusted based on your needs, but it’s important to allocate enough space for each OS.
2. Boot Manager: UEFI has its own built-in boot manager that can handle multiple operating systems. It allows you to choose which OS to boot into when starting up your computer.
3. Secure Boot: UEFI includes a feature called Secure Boot that helps protect against malware during the boot process. However, enabling Secure Boot may require additional steps when installing an operating system, especially if it is not digitally signed by a trusted authority.
4. Compatibility: Not all operating systems are compatible with UEFI. Before attempting a dual boot, ensure that both operating systems support UEFI or else you may encounter compatibility issues.
5. Drivers and Software: Different operating systems may require specific drivers and software packages to function properly in a dual boot setup. It’s important to ensure that all necessary drivers and software are installed for each OS.
Preparing Your System:
Before delving into the process of disabling UEFI, it’s crucial to perform a few preliminary steps to ensure a smooth transition:
- Backup Your Data: Always back up your important data before making any major changes to your system. This precautionary step ensures that your data remains safe in case anything goes wrong.
- Create a Bootable USB: Prepare a bootable USB drive containing the operating system you intend to install. You’ll use this USB drive to install the new OS alongside your existing one.
Disabling UEFI for Dual Booting:
- Access UEFI/BIOS Settings: Restart your computer and enter the UEFI/BIOS settings by pressing the designated key during startup. Common keys include F2, F10, F12, or Delete, depending on your system’s manufacturer.
- Navigate to UEFI Settings: Within the UEFI settings, navigate to the “Boot” or “Startup” section, where you’ll find options related to boot order and boot modes.
- Disable Secure Boot: Secure Boot is a UEFI feature that ensures the system only boots with trusted software. Disable Secure Boot to allow the installation of non-Windows operating systems. Some systems require you to enter a secure boot password to disable it.
- Switch to Legacy Boot Mode: If your UEFI settings offer a choice between UEFI and Legacy (BIOS) boot modes, switch to Legacy mode. This mode allows you to install operating systems that might not be fully UEFI-compatible.
- Enable CSM (Compatibility Support Module): Some UEFI settings include an option called CSM, which provides support for legacy boot devices. Enabling CSM can enhance compatibility with older operating systems.
Installing Your Desired Operating System:
With UEFI disabled and the necessary settings adjusted, you’re now ready to install your desired operating system alongside the existing one:
- Boot from the USB Drive: Restart your computer and boot from the USB drive containing the installation files for your chosen operating system.
- Follow Installation Instructions: Follow the on-screen instructions to install the new operating system. During the installation process, you’ll be prompted to choose a partition for the new OS. Be careful not to overwrite the existing OS partition.
- Partition Management: If you’re installing a Linux distribution, it’s essential to create appropriate partitions, including a root partition and a swap partition. Ensure that you’re installing the new OS on a separate partition from the existing one.
- Install Bootloader: For Linux distributions, the bootloader (usually GRUB) needs to be installed on the same partition as the new OS. This bootloader will allow you to choose between operating systems during startup.
Once the installation is complete, there are a few additional steps to take:
- Configure Boot Order: Return to the UEFI settings and configure the boot order to prioritise the bootloader of the new operating system. This ensures that you can easily choose between the different OS options during startup.
- Test the Dual Boot: Restart your computer and test the dual boot configuration. You should see a menu that allows you to select between the different operating systems installed on your device.
In order to facilitate the dual booting of various operating systems, it is imperative to approach the process of disabling UEFI with meticulous deliberation and a methodical methodology. By adhering to the procedures delineated in this instructional manual, one can effectively surmount the obstacles presented by UEFI and establish a cohesive milieu conducive to the simultaneous operation of multiple operating systems on a solitary device. It is important to bear in mind that although dual booting provides flexibility, it also necessitates careful consideration and appropriate configuration in order to guarantee the stability and efficiency of both operating systems.